Nuts...
Australia produces per annum 40% of the global Macadamia commercial harvest, which currently means we contribute more mac nuts to the global economy than any other nation. Of that 40%, most comes from the Byron Shire, NSW, Australia. There are two very rare macadamia trees which are only to be found in the valley I live in and the valley next door. Strobist info; Two speedlights. KEY is rear centre firing on 1/8th power through a 43inch Westcott umbrella, gelled with 1/4 CTO (outside kitchen window). FILL is just to camera left, firing through homemade ringlight, 1/8th power, gelled with a gold celophane. Background bokeh is some metal lattice work with a few blue gels scattered over the top.
